So I have been collecting files, mainly ship images, off these forums and a couple of other places for quite some time for my own use to enhance my game. I decided to take some time and put them all together with the release of Universe, there are 3,567 images in my shipsets folder alone. There are also tons of flags, space themed music, etc.
I split the Kitchen sink into two part images and sounds. Please be aware that not everything is made to perfectly fit into a Universe folder structure, its more just so stuff is easier to find, and some of the individual files may need some work, renaming, some of the ships need re-scaling (according to the guide ships should be 300x300 or less lighting corrected, and engine and running lights added etc.
For the planet images they are in subfolders from the original posting as the overlays matter, Would be nice to see a comprehensive planet HD overhaul.

Guys, if you can't download the files from GameFront, just use a proxy to access it. If you don't know how to do it, follow these steps:
1. Use Firefox.
2. Use Firefox (seriously guys, you should use it...).
3. Search on Google "firefox addon anonymox" and click on first link.
4. Click on "Add to Firefox" and give permission to install it. Restart Firefox.
5. Click on the new installed addon's X ( the big black X should be somewhere in the address bar or in the bar at the bottom )
6. Click on active and choose a Country ( UK works just fine )
7. Go to the GameFront links and download.
Of course the download will be slower because the files are being downloaded via the proxy.
